Linux(debuntu)在控制台模式下的JavaFX多点触控应用程序

时间:2018-11-16 14:09:26

标签: java linux javafx multi-touch headless

我刚刚尝试了触摸/手势application from Danno Ferrin。 现在,我想让它在我的debuntu系统上以控制台模式运行(意味着不运行X服务器)。显示器为eGalax EXC3000,并且已安装适当的驱动程序。 最初的尝试是使其与here 的无头linux系统的Monocle定制OpenJFX 8构建一起工作。

我编译一个.jar,切换到控制台模式(Ctrl + Alt + F1),然后使用以下JVM参数运行jar:

java -Dglass.platform=Monocle -Dmonocle.platform=Linux -Dprism.order=sw -jar target/headlessfx-0.0.1-SNAPSHOT-jar-with-dependencies.jar

应用程序显示并识别触摸点(至少在“非手势”部分中显示了它们的坐标)。但是多点触摸/手势似乎无法正常工作,因为没有可视化反馈,并且“手势”部分中没有任何显示。

有人对如何解决这个问题有想法吗,或者可以给我一些提示,以使多点触摸手势在这种情况下可以正常工作?

一般来说,多点触控都可以在此显示器上使用,因为当我启动Chrome(当然不是在控制台模式下)时,我可以缩放和滚动它,就像一个超级按钮。因此,目前我正在寻找有关Chrome如何处理此问题的详细信息。

非常感谢!

0 个答案:

没有答案